Output ed904fc76ca3e14d41cdf8f2e728a44d60fafbe92da181d73d768667fcb24f8d:12

value
86624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3ff8514f913c504b6a4e196d1663149d635a37 OP_EQUAL
address
3BZPXyTr5Jfb2bJ73wmsgYZReHhL3z4s1w
transaction
ed904fc76ca3e14d41cdf8f2e728a44d60fafbe92da181d73d768667fcb24f8d
spent
true